Avahi is an implementation of the DNS Service Discovery and Multicast
DNS specifications for Zeroconf Computing. It uses D-Bus for
communication between user applications and a system daemon. The daemon
is used to coordinate application efforts in caching replies, necessary
to minimize the traffic imposed on networks.
The Avahi mDNS responder is now complete with features, implementing
all MUSTs and the majority of the SHOULDs of the mDNS and DNS-SD RFCs.
It passes all tests in the Apple Bonjour conformance test suite. In
addition, it supports some nifty things, like correct mDNS reflection
across LAN segments.
